Minister of Science and Higher Education Valery Falkov Congratulated Scientists on Russian Science Day

This holiday is not only an occasion to remember the great achievements of the past but also an opportunity to look into the future that we are building today.

We proudly recall the outstanding Russian scientists and engineers whose names are forever inscribed in the history of world science.

Nikolai Zhukovsky, the founder of hydro- and aerodynamics; Sergey Korolev, who opened the path to space for humanity; Andrey Tupolev, the creator of legendary aircraft – these are just a few examples of how the inventions of our scientists set the pace for scientific and technological progress worldwide.

Today’s scientists and engineers continue this glorious tradition. Thanks to your efforts, Russia remains a leader in nuclear energy, medicine, and is achieving success in artificial intelligence and many other fields.

We take great pride in the significant growth of interest in science among schoolchildren and students. More and more young scholars are joining our research organizations. At the same time, cooperation between universities, research institutes, and the real sector of the economy is strengthening.

For its part, the Ministry of Science and Higher Education of Russia is creating the necessary conditions for scientific creativity. Laboratory equipment is being modernized, grant support is being strengthened, and new youth laboratories are being opened.

Dear colleagues! May your work always be in demand, and may your ideas come to life. I wish you good health, boundless energy, and new discoveries that will strengthen the power and prosperity of our Motherland.
